/*焦点图*/
.focus{ position:relative; width:1001px; height:270px; background-color: #000; float: left;}  
.focus img{ width: 1001px; height: 270px;} 
.focus .shadow .title{width: 260px; height: 65px;padding-left: 30px;padding-top: 20px;}
.focus .shadow .title a{ text-decoration:none; color:#ffffff; font-size:14px; font-weight:bolder; overflow:hidden; }
.focus .btn{ position:absolute; bottom:34px; left:510px; overflow:hidden; zoom:1;} 
.focus .btn a{position:relative; display:inline; width:13px; height:13px; border-radius:7px; margin:0 5px;color:#B0B0B0;font:13px/15px "\5B8B\4F53"; text-decoration:none; text-align:center; outline:0; float:left; background:#D9D9D9; }  
.focus .btn a:hover,.focus .btn a.current{  cursor:pointer;background:#fc114a;}  
.focus .fPic{ position:absolute; left:0px; top:0px; }  
.focus .D1fBt{ overflow:hidden; zoom:1;  height:16px; z-index:10;  }  
.focus .shadow{ width:100%; position:absolute; bottom:0; left:0px; z-index:10; height:80px; line-height: 80px; background:rgba(0,0,0,0.6);    
filter:progid:DXImageTransform.Microsoft.gradient( GradientType = 0,startColorstr = '#80000000',endColorstr = '#80000000')\9;  display:block;  text-align:left; }  
.focus .shadow a{ text-decoration:none; color:#ffffff; font-size:20px; overflow:hidden; margin-left:10px; font-family: "\5FAE\8F6F\96C5\9ED1";}  
.focus .fcon{ position:relative; width:100%; float:left;  display:none; background:#000  }  
.focus .fcon img{ display:block; }  
.focus .fbg{bottom:25px; right:40px; position:absolute; height:21px; text-align:center; z-index: 200; }  
.focus .fbg div{margin:4px auto 0;overflow:hidden;zoom:1;height:14px}    
.focus .D1fBt a{position:relative; display:inline; width:13px; height:13px; border-radius:7px; margin:0 5px;color:#B0B0B0;font:13px/15px "\5B8B\4F53"; text-decoration:none; text-align:center; outline:0; float:left; background:#D9D9D9; }    
.focus .D1fBt .current,.focus .D1fBt a:hover{background:#ffffff;}    
.focus .D1fBt img{display:none}    
.focus .D1fBt i{display:none; font-style:normal; }    
.focus .prev,.focus .next{position:absolute;width:40px;height:74px;background: url(../images/focus_btn.png) no-repeat;}
.focus .prev{top: 50%;margin-top: -37px; left: 0;background-position:0 -74px; cursor:pointer; }  
.focus .next{top: 50%;margin-top: -37px; right: 0;  background-position:-40px -74px;  cursor:pointer;}  
.focus .prev:hover{  background-position:0 0; }  
.focus .next:hover{  background-position:-40px 0;}  
.cdbg {
	background-image: url(../images/cdbg.jpg);
	background-repeat: repeat-x;
}
.sywzbt1 {font-size: 13px;
	color: #FFF;
}
.syenbt1 {font-size: 13px;
	color: #136aa0;
}
.sy_rbk {
	background-image: url(../images/syrbk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.sy_cd_bg {
	background-image: url(../images/leftcdbk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.sy_lcdbt_bg {
	background-image: url(../images/sy_left_bg.jpg);
	background-repeat: no-repeat;
	background-position: left center;
}
.sy_lcd_lrbg {
	background-image: url(../images/sy_lcdlr_bg.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.sypcxx_bk1 {
	background-image:url(../images/sy_psxx_bk1.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.syzzyy_bk {
	background-image: url(../images/sy_zl_bk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.sygdtp_bk {
	background-image: url(../images/gdgg_bk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.link_wz_bt {color:#fff;
	font-size: 13px;
}
.bott_wz { font-size:13px;
color:#FFFFFF;
}
.syhybk {
	background-image: url(../images/sy_hydt_bk.png);
	background-repeat: no-repeat;
}
.sy_rycbk {
	background-image: url(../images/sy_rlrbk.png);
	background-repeat: no-repeat;
	background-position: right top;
}.fy_gywmlbk {
	background-image: url(../images/fygywm_lbk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.gywmwz {
	font-size: 13px;
	color: #FFF;
}
a.sy_gg_bt:link {
	font-size: 22px;
	color: #F00;
	line-height: 23px;
	text-decoration: none;
	font-weight: bold;
}
a.sy_gg_bt:visited { font-size: 212px;
	color: #F00;font-weight: bold;
	line-height: 23px; text-decoration: none}
a.sy_gg_bt:hover {  font-size: 22px;
	color: #F00;font-weight: bold;
	line-height: 23px;text-decoration: none}
a.sy_gg_bt:active { font-size: 22px;
	color: #F00;font-weight: bold;
	line-height: 23px; text-decoration: none}
a.fyl_cd:link {  font-size: 13px;color: #146aa1; text-decoration: none}
a.fyl_cd:visited { font-size: 13px;color: #146aa1; text-decoration: none}
a.fyl_cd:hover {  font-size: 13px;color: #146aa1;text-decoration: none}
a.fyl_cd:active { font-size: 13px;color: #146aa1; text-decoration: none}
a.fyl_gg:link {  font-size: 13px;color: #146aa1; font-weight: bold;text-decoration: none}
a.fyl_gg:visited { font-size: 13px;color: #146aa1; font-weight: bold;text-decoration: none}
a.fyl_gg:hover {  font-size: 13px;color: #146aa1;font-weight: bold;text-decoration: none}
a.fyl_gg:active { font-size: 13px;color: #146aa1;font-weight: bold; text-decoration: none}
a.fyl_cd1:link { font-size: 13px;color: #000000; text-decoration: none}
a.fyl_cd1:visited { font-size: 13px;color: #000000; text-decoration: none}
a.fyl_cd1:hover {  font-size: 13px;color: #146aa1;text-decoration: none}
a.fyl_cd1:active {font-size: 13px; color: #146aa1; text-decoration: none}
a.yqsbcbt:link { font-size: 13px;color: #828282; text-decoration: none}
a.yqsbcbt:visited { font-size: 13px;color: #828282; text-decoration: none}
a.yqsbcbt:hover {  font-size: 13px;color: #828282;text-decoration: none}
a.yqsbcbt:active {font-size: 13px; color: #828282; text-decoration: none}.news_lbk {
	background-image: url(../images/news_lbk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.fwfw_bk {
	background-image: url(../images/fw_bk.png);
	background-repeat: no-repeat;
	background-position: left top;
}
.sswbk {
	height: 26px;
	width: 211px;
	border-top-style: none;
	border-right-style: none;
	border-bottom-style: none;
	border-left-style: none;
	text-indent: 1;
}
.ssal {
	background-image: url(../images/ssal.png);
	background-repeat: no-repeat;
	background-position: center center;
	height: 26px;
	width: 28px;
	border-top-style: none;
	border-right-style: none;
	border-bottom-style: none;
	border-left-style: none;
}
